Sr. Staff/ Principal Digital Design Engineer- InnoPhase IoT (San Diego)

As a Sr. Staff/ Principal Digital Design Engineer, you will be working with a team of design engineers to develop novel SoC products for connectivity and communications. You will also be a key contributor to product definition and resulting detailed device performance and functional requirements specifications.

In addition to delivering high quality digital solutions in the context of the product architecture, the team supports other disciplines with work products such as Verilog stimulus files, test benches for device bring up/characterization, test vectors for product manufacturing, etc.

Key Responsibilities

Contribute to/review SoC specifications and architectures

Front to back digital design and verification RTL through physical implementation

Hands on technical leadership

Support schedule and resource planning

Help define and socialize digital/system design, implementation methodologies and test strategies and flows

Debug designs and provide timely closure

Work with System, Software, RF, Analog, and Test teams and provide necessary support
